Meghan Markle's highly anticipated series, With Love, Meghan, has been met with a wave of negative reviews from TV critics. The lifestyle show, which was finally released on Netflix on Tuesday (March 4), features cooking, baking, gardening and other hostess activities.

Despite Meghan's aim to share her "personal tips and tricks", while "embracing playfulness over perfection" and "highlighting how to create beauty in unexpected ways", the series has not been well received.

The Independent described the show as "exhausting" and likened the crafting tasks to "one part Pinterest, one part posh Blue Peter".

Katie Rosseinsky wrote: "The heady blend of aesthetic curation, inspiring truisms and those inescapable edible flowers might well leave you feeling a bit queasy – or simply worn out at the prospect of having to adequately perform gratitude for all the thoughtful touches involved in Meghan's 'guest experience'."

The Express reports how The Daily Mail brutally stated: "It is so awful it is almost compelling and sources within Netflix hope it will prove irresistible to a 'hate-watch' audience of those who don't like Meghan."

Marina Hyde, The Guardian columnist and host of The Rest is Entertainment, has dished out a critique on Meghan Markle's new domestic pivot. Hyde remarked: "For Meghan, it's supposed to assist her transformation into domestic guru.

"If you don't mind arching an eyebrow at the lifestyle lunacies of fellow Montecito resident Gwyneth Paltrow, then at least have some consistency and give yourself a pass on this one. This show is sensationally absurd and trite, and if you watch it, you know it."

Other media outlets, however, have leaned into the appeal of the series. The Standard lavished four stars on the show, highlighting the cooking tips and guest conversations with cooks.

In her piece, Melanie McDonagh mused on the show's potential: "So, will this series fly? For laughs perhaps. But if you're the kind of person who wants to be shown how to make a daisy chain or who gets a thrill from seeing the home life of our Duchess as she wants us to see it, or who wants tips on making pasta the way no Italian ever did (sitting on veg, in a frying pan cooked with water from a kettle), why it'll be just your cup of tea."

Despite approaching the show with some scepticism over its claims of genre-redefining, Radio Times' Caroline Frost offered a more gracious view in her assessment.

She commented: "This isn’t the most offensive TV show in the world, and useful for those who need to know how to pour Epsom salts into a jar, pour boiling water over pasta and daisies on a plate, but Brooklyn Beckham needn’t worry about giving up his chef’s hat just yet.

"Meghan says she’s hoping to make magic out of 'elevating ordinary things'. But this ordinary? Will enough people find basic sufficiently beautiful to get the hordes buying the merchandise as is the plan?

"Time will tell. Has Meghan reimagined the genre as promised? Not so much, but I’ll keep watching."

With Love, Meghan features appearances from celebrities like Mindy Kaling, Abigail Spencer and Victoria Jackson as well as celebrity chefs Roy Choi and Alice Waters.

With Love, Meghan forms part of a lucrative deal inked with Netflix back in September 2020, where the Sussexes pledged to "develop scripted and unscripted series, film, documentaries, and children programming for the streaming service".

The series follows Harry & Meghan, which was released in 2024.

All episodes of With Love, Meghan are currently available on Netflix.

What are Twitter (X) Worldwide Trends?
Twitter (X) Worldwide trends are a list of topics that are currently being talked about on the platform and also world. The topics on this list change in real-time and are based on the volume of tweets using a particular hashtag or keyword. Twitter (X) Worldwide trends can be localized to a Worldwide country or region or can be global, depending on the topic's popularity.

How Do Twitter (X) Worldwide Trends Work?
Twitter (X) Worldwide trends are generated by an algorithm that analyzes the volume of tweets using a particular hashtag or keyword. When the algorithm detects a sudden increase in tweets using a specific hashtag or keyword, it considers that topic to be trending.

Once a topic is identified as trending, it is added to the list of Twitter (X) Worldwide trends. The topics on this list are ranked based on their popularity, with the most popular topics appearing at the top of the list.

Twitter (X) Worldwide trends can be filtered by location or category, allowing users to see what topics are trending in their area or in a particular industry. Additionally, users can click on a trending topic to see all of the tweets using that hashtag or keyword.
